Turns out Arnold doesn't have a motorcycle endorsement on his license. He was not ticketed as the state law has some confusion, motorcycles have less than 4 wheels, & require a M1 endorsement, cars have more than 3 wheels, & no M1 endorsement is needed.
His spokesperson said that Arnold admits he needs to get the M1 endorsement.
Nice to be governor.
Seems to me between not having an M1 endorsement, apparantly not wearing a full face helmet, Arnold is not a serious rider. Oh well.
